(51) MONTREAL vs. (52) PITTSBURGH
Lean: PITTSBURGH on the money line.
Backing a National Hockey League team (Pittsburgh) that has played in five straight games where they have outshot their opponent by 6 or more shots has been a money making proposition over the last five NHL campaigns. The trend is 69-21 (77%) and the bias is 7-4 this season.

(57) FLORIDA vs. (58) CHICAGO
Lean: Under on the total.
Playing to the low side of a National Hockey League over-under on a team (Chicago) that has allowed 2.85 goals per game coming off a win by 4 goals or more has been a 68% proposition over the last 15 NHL campaigns. The trend is 96-45 over that span and the bias is 5-2 this season.
